In August 2009, the government of Turkiye extended the definitive duty imposed on certain types of motorcycle tyres and motorcycle tubes from China and Thailand following the conclusion of a sunset review. In July 2014, a sunset review was initiated and the definitive duty was extended for a new period in July 2015. In July 2020, a sunset review was initiated and the definitive duty was extended for a new period in January 2022.
